24-Year-Old Female Racer Ready to Get Back on Track with VP Racing at Greenville

MOORESVILLE, NC (March 22, 2011) – Michelle Theriault is set to return to the driver’s seat in the NASCAR K&N Pro Series East for the entire 2011 season. The 24-year-old driver will pilot the No. 45 ProGold Lubricants, Southern Woods N’ Water TV Toyota for VP Racing in 2011 and is set to make her debut in the series opener at Greenville Pickens Speedway (S.C.) on Saturday, March 26 .

Theriault is certainly no stranger to Greenville’s half-mile oval and has competed there in the K&N Pro Series East (formerly the Camping World East Series) and Whelen All-American Late Model Series. In 2007, Theriault made history at Greenville Pickens Speedway when she became the highest finishing female in the K&N Pro Series and the first female to secure a pole starting position.

“I am really excited to get the season started at Greenville Pickens Speedway,” said Theriault. “I really enjoy racing at the track and have had some success there in the past.  I can’t think of a better place to jump start our 2011 season, and I look forward to getting the season off to a strong start.”

In addition to her partnership with ProGold Lubricants for the 2011 season, Theriault will also receive support from Southern Woods N’ Water TV, a Christian-based reality show that documents some of the best hunting and fishing opportunities in North America.

“ProGold Lubricants is on board with us again for the 2011 season, and we couldn’t be happier to have their support,” said Theriault. “It’s also exciting to have the support of Southern Woods N’ Water TV as we head into our first race of the season. I am eager to return to familiar roots in the K&N Pro Series East and to continue developing my skills on the track.”

Theriault will hit the track at Greenville Pickens Speedway at 1:00 p.m. EST on Saturday for the first NASCAR K&N Pro Series East practice session of the 2011 season, followed by qualifying for theKevin Whitaker Chevrolet 150 at 6:00 p.m.  The green flag will drop for 150-lap feature event at 8:00 p.m.

Michelle Theriault and the No. 45 ProGold Lubricants Toyota Fast Facts:

Theriault at Greenville: Theriault made her K&N East Series debut at Greenville Pickens Speedway in 2007 where she started in the 21st position and drove to an eighth-place finish, becoming the highest finishing female in the series.  Theriault has also competed in the Whelen All-American Late Model at Series at Greenville where she became the first female to start a feature from the pole position.

Return to the East: 2011 marks Theriault’s return to the East Series for the first time since her rookie season in 2007.  Theriault notched three top-10 finishes (Greenville, Elko, Iowa) in just 13 starts during the 2007 season.

K&N East Series Did You Know?: The NASCAR K&N Pro Series East schedule consists of 12 events and will travel to 10 different tracks throughout the 2011 season. The series will also visit select tracks in tandem with the NASCAR Sprint Cup Series including Richmond International Speedway (VA), New Hampshire Motor Speedway and Dover International Speedway (DE). The NASCAR K&N Pro Series East will also travel to Bowman Gray Stadium (NC) for the first time since its premiere season in 1987.
